#ifndef __TAI_FRAMEWORK_PLATFORM_HPP__
#define __TAI_FRAMEWORK_PLATFORM_HPP__
#include "object.hpp"
namespace tai::framework {
using Location = std::string;
class Platform {
public:
Platform(const tai_service_method_table_t * services) : m_services(services) {};
virtual ~Platform() {};
virtual tai_status_t create(tai_object_type_t type, tai_object_id_t module_id, uint32_t attr_count, const tai_attribute_t *attr_list, tai_object_id_t *id) { return TAI_STATUS_NOT_SUPPORTED; }
tai_status_t create(tai_object_type_t type, uint32_t attr_count, const tai_attribute_t *attr_list, tai_object_id_t *id) {
return create(type, TAI_NULL_OBJECT_ID, attr_count, attr_list, id);
}
virtual tai_status_t remove(tai_object_id_t id) = 0;
S_BaseObject get(tai_object_id_t id, tai_object_type_t filter = TAI_OBJECT_TYPE_NULL) {
auto it = m_objects.find(id);
if ( it == m_objects.end() ) {
return nullptr;
}
if ( filter == TAI_OBJECT_TYPE_NULL || it->second->type() == filter ) {
return it->second;
}
return nullptr;
}
virtual tai_object_type_t get_object_type(tai_object_id_t id) = 0;
virtual tai_object_id_t get_module_id(tai_object_id_t id) = 0;
virtual tai_status_t set_log(tai_api_t tai_api_id, tai_log_level_t log_level, tai_log_fn log_fn) {
return TAI_STATUS_SUCCESS;
}
virtual tai_status_t list_metadata(const tai_metadata_key_t *const key, uint32_t *count, const tai_attr_metadata_t *const **list) {
auto type = key->type;
if ( key->oid != TAI_NULL_OBJECT_ID ) {
type = get_object_type(key->oid);
}
auto info = tai_metadata_all_object_type_infos[type];
if ( info == nullptr ) {
*count = tai_metadata_attr_sorted_by_id_name_count;
*list = tai_metadata_attr_sorted_by_id_name;
return TAI_STATUS_SUCCESS;
}
*count = info->attrmetadatalength;
*list = info->attrmetadata;
return TAI_STATUS_SUCCESS;
}
virtual const tai_attr_metadata_t* get_attr_metadata(const tai_metadata_key_t *const key, tai_attr_id_t attr_id) {
auto type = key->type;
if ( key->oid != TAI_NULL_OBJECT_ID ) {
type = get_object_type(key->oid);
}
return tai_metadata_get_attr_metadata(type, attr_id);
}
virtual const tai_object_type_info_t* get_object_info(const tai_metadata_key_t *const key) {
auto type = key->type;
if ( key->oid != TAI_NULL_OBJECT_ID ) {
type = get_object_type(key->oid);
}
return tai_metadata_get_object_type_info(type);
}
protected:
const tai_service_method_table_t * m_services;
// we don't need a lock to access m_objects/m_fsms since TAI API is not thread-safe
std::map<tai_object_id_t, S_BaseObject> m_objects;
std::map<Location, S_FSM> m_fsms;
};
};
#endif // __PLATFORM_HPP__
